As an Advanced Practice Provider in our REI clinic, you will work collaboratively with reproductive endocrinologists to provide comprehensive care to patients experiencing infertility and reproductive health issues. You will play a crucial role in patient evaluation, treatment planning, and ongoing management throughout their fertility journey. 

 

Position Details: 

  • Hours: 7:00 am-3:30 pm with flexibility, 5 days a week 

  • Full-time 

  • 8 MDs, 2 APP 

  • 5-6x year first call. Some remote, some onsite 

 

Key Responsibilities: 

  • Conduct initial patient consultations and follow-up appointments, taking comprehensive medical histories and performing physical examinations. 
  • Order and interpret diagnostic tests, including hormone panels, ultrasounds, and other relevant studies. 
  • Develop and implement treatment plans in collaboration with reproductive endocrinologists. 
  • Monitor and adjust medication protocols for ovulation induction and controlled ovarian hyperstimulation. 
  • Provide patient education on fertility treatments, medications, and lifestyle modifications. 
  • Counsel patients on genetic screening options and results. 
  • Collaborate with the embryology lab to coordinate in vitro fertilization (IVF) cycles. 
  • Manage early pregnancy care for patients who have undergone fertility treatments. 
  • Participate in research activities and quality improvement initiatives within the REI department. 
  • Maintain accurate and detailed electronic medical records. 
  • Stay current with the latest advancements in reproductive medicine and evidence-based practices.

About Advocate Health 

Advocate Health is the third-largest nonprofit, integrated health system in the United States, created from the combination of Advocate Aurora Health and Atrium Health. Providing care under the names Advocate Health Care in Illinois; Atrium Health in the Carolinas, Georgia and Alabama; and Aurora Health Care in Wisconsin, Advocate Health is a national leader in clinical innovation, health outcomes, consumer experience and value-based care. Headquartered in Charlotte, North Carolina, Advocate Health services nearly 6 million patients and is engaged in hundreds of clinical trials and research studies, with Wake Forest University School of Medicine serving as the academic core of the enterprise. It is nationally recognized for its expertise in cardiology, neurosciences, oncology, pediatrics and rehabilitation, as well as organ transplants, burn treatments and specialized musculoskeletal programs. Advocate Health employs 155,000 teammates across 69 hospitals and over 1,000 care locations, and offers one of the nation’s largest graduate medical education programs with over 2,000 residents and fellows across more than 200 programs. Committed to providing equitable care for all, Advocate Health provides more than $6 billion in annual community benefits.
